Welcome to Puzzle
Puzzle is a comprehensive asset management platform that helps you take control of your assets in real-time. Whether you're managing crypto, stocks, real estates, T-bills, or cash, Puzzle provides the tools you need.
What is Puzzle?
Puzzle is a Django-based asset management application designed for businesses and sole traders who need meticulous asset tracking and management. Unlike centralized platforms, Puzzle respects your privacy and gives you complete control over your financial data.
Key Features
- Real-time Asset Tracking: Monitor crypto, stocks, real estate, T-bills, and cash in one unified interface
- Automated Invoicing System: Generate and manage invoices automatically
- Exchange Integrations: Connect with major cryptocurrency exchanges like Kraken and Coinbase
- Double-Entry Accounting: Built-in accounting system with automatic transaction leg creation
- Privacy-First: Self-hosted solution that keeps your data under your control
- Enterprise Ready: Actively used by successful companies in various industries
Quick Start
Get started with Puzzle in just a few steps:
- Installation: Set up your development environment
- Configuration: Configure your exchanges and settings
Architecture Overview
Puzzle is built on a robust, scalable architecture:
- PostgreSQL: Primary relational database for trades, accounts, and entities
- InfluxDB: Time-series database for price history and market data
- Redis: Real-time communication middleware
- Django: Web framework with admin interface
- CCXT: Cryptocurrency exchange integrations
Who Uses Puzzle?
Puzzle is actively used by successful companies including:
- BaDaaS: A cryptography laboratory based in Belgium
- LeakIX: A cybersecurity company providing Internet asset overviews
Enterprise Features
Need enterprise features or support? Contact us at contact@badaas.be for:
- Custom integrations
- Professional support
- Enterprise deployment assistance
- Custom feature development
Philosophy
At BaDaaS, we believe cypherpunks must build free and open source software that helps people maintain their privacy. Puzzle embodies this philosophy by providing a powerful, self-hosted alternative to centralized asset management platforms.
Next Steps
Ready to get started? Head over to our Installation Guide to set up your first Puzzle instance.